Manage and maintain relationships with FCC software customers, partners and potential partners to ensure maximum reach and engagement in the Canadian AgTech market.

What you’ll do:

  • Proactively develop and maintain relationships with customers and key influencers
  • Represent FCC at trade shows and industry events
  • Contact customers directly through personal visits, email, or telephone
  • Organize and deliver seminars and webinars to customers and prospects
  • Help develop marketing strategies and programs to promote AgExpert software

What we’re looking for:

  • Trusted team member who focuses on the customer
  • Problem-solver who is able to identify and recommend opportunities for improvement
  • Relationship-builder able to work with internal and external partners
  • Skilled communicator who can turn technical concepts, jargon and information into plain language

What you’ll need:

  • Diploma or undergraduate degree in agriculture, business or marketing and at least four years of experience (or an equivalent combination of education and experience)
